Abstract: | This paper considers a particular case of linear bilevel programming problems with one leader and multiple followers. In this
model, the followers are independent, meaning that the objective function and the set of constraints of each follower only
include the leader’s variables and his own variables. We prove that this problem can be reformulated into a linear bilevel
problem with one leader and one follower by defining an adequate second level objective function and constraint region. In
the second part of the paper we show that the results on the optimality of the linear bilevel problem with multiple independent
followers presented in Shi et al. The kth-best approach for linear bilevel multi-follower programming, J. Global Optim. 33, 563–578 (2005)] are based on a misconstruction
of the inducible region. |
